Experience the freedom of the open road in Germany as you embark on an unforgettable 6-day road trip! This experience caters to every traveler, featuring destinations like Cologne, Höningen, Frankfurt, Sinsheim, Stuttgart, Heidelberg, Königswinter, and Brühl.

This perfectly planned road trip itinerary in Germany takes you through some of the best places to see in the country. You will spend 2 nights in Cologne, 1 night in Frankfurt, 1 night in Stuttgart, and 1 night in Heidelberg. Day 2 – Cologne, Höningen, and Frankfurt

Drive 212 km, 3 hours 5 min

Embark on another extraordinary experience on day 2 of your road trip in Germany. Today, you will make 2 stops and experience some of the highlights of Cologne, and Höningen. At the end of the day, you will enjoy the comforts of a top-rated hotel in Frankfurt, which will be your home away from home for 1 night.

Start your sightseeing with a visit to Lindt Chocolate Museum. This museum is rated an average of 4.3 out of 5 stars from 37,446 visitors.

Cologne Zoological Garden is another popular attraction you could visit today. This zoo has a rating of 4.4 out of 5 stars from 30,676 visitors.

Cologne Cathedral is also highly recommended by travelers. More than 5,000,000 people visit this top attraction every year. This catholic cathedral has a rating of 4.8 out of 5 stars from 70,814 visitors.

Fasten your seatbelt and make your way to your next stop. Höningen, home to many well-known sights in the region, is a lovely destination on today’s itinerary. Keep in mind that your travel time from Cologne to Höningen may take around 16 min without traffic disruptions. Upon arrival in Höningen, we highly recommend checking out some of the top attractions.

A top pick for your self-guided sightseeing tour today is Äußerer Grüngürtel. Previous visitors have rated this park an average of 4.5 out of 5 stars in 2,024 reviews.
